Market Size and Growth Outlook

IoT For Public Safety Market size is projected to grow steadily from USD 3.07 billion in 2025 to USD 13.78 billion by 2035, demonstrating a CAGR exceeding 16.2% through the forecast period (2026-2035). The 2026 revenue is estimated at USD 3.51 billion.

Key Takeaways

  • North America region accounted for over 39% revenue share in 2025, supported by strong government investments in smart city projects and public safety infrastructure in North America.
  • Asia Pacific region will expand at over 18.6% CAGR from 2026 to 2035, accelerated by urbanization, rising public safety concerns and large-scale smart city deployments in APAC.
  • The solution segment dominated the market in 2025, driven by the rising integration of IoT solutions such as realโ€‘time monitoring and data analytics that enhance public safety operations and emergency response efficiency.
  • In 2025, the surveillance and security segment contributed the largest share to the IoT for public safety market, driven by increasing deployment of connected cameras and sensors in urban environments to enhance realโ€‘time monitoring and public safety in the Surveillance and Security segment.
  • The homeland security segment led the market in 2025, propelled by rising global focus on national security and investments in advanced realโ€‘time monitoring and threat detection systems within the Homeland Security segment.
  • Key companies dominating the IoT for public safety market are Honeywell (USA), Cisco Systems (USA), Motorola Solutions (USA), Siemens (Germany), Bosch (Germany), Huawei (China), NEC Corporation (Japan), Airbus (France), Thales Group (France), Johnson Controls (USA).

Market Growth Drivers and Industry Trends

Rising Adoption of IoT for Public Safety Monitoring

The growing integration of IoT technologies in public safety monitoring is a pivotal force shaping the iot for public safety market. Agencies like the Department of Homeland Security (DHS) have increasingly endorsed IoT-driven surveillance and alert systems to enhance emergency response and crime prevention capabilities. This aligns with heightened public demand for safer urban environments and prompt incident management. Leading companies such as Motorola Solutions are capitalizing on these trends by deploying interconnected platforms that facilitate efficient data sharing across law enforcement and emergency services. For established firms, this underscores opportunities to develop advanced, interoperable IoT solutions, while new entrants can specialize in niche applications like predictive analytics or community-driven safety networks. As public safety demands evolve alongside digital expectations, IoT monitoring adoption promises continual relevance anchored in real-world security imperatives.

Expansion of Smart City and Connected Infrastructure Initiatives

Smart city and connected infrastructure projects are accelerating adoption within the iot for public safety market by embedding IoT systems into urban planning frameworks. Organizations such as the Smart Cities Council report widespread investments in sensor networks and integrated communication platforms to optimize traffic management, disaster response, and public health monitoring. These initiatives reflect broader governmental commitments, exemplified by the European Unionโ€™s Horizon 2020 program, to build resilient and sustainable urban ecosystems. This integration creates strategic openings for solution providers to align offerings with multi-sectoral infrastructure deployments, fostering cross-industry collaboration and scalable innovation. The ongoing evolution of smart city ecosystems signals a durable, infrastructural adoption of IoT for public safety, where data interoperability and system resilience will remain paramount.

Technological Advancements in Sensors and Real-Time Monitoring

Progress in sensor technologies and real-time data analytics continues to accelerate development within the iot for public safety market. Advances in AI-powered visual sensors, as demonstrated by companies like Hikvision and FLIR Systems, enhance situational awareness through improved accuracy and speed of threat detection. Additionally, real-time monitoring is increasingly integrated with cloud-based platforms, exemplified by IBMโ€™s Watson IoT solutions, enabling rapid decision-making and coordinated incident responses. These technological improvements allow both incumbents and startups to differentiate through enhanced functionality and responsiveness. As sensor miniaturization and energy efficiency improve further, real-time IoT monitoring will solidify as a core component of public safety infrastructure, facilitating proactive and adaptive risk management tailored to diverse operational demands.

Industry Restraints:

Cybersecurity Concerns and Data Privacy Risks

The pervasive risk of cyberattacks and data breaches significantly hampers adoption of IoT solutions in public safety, as these networks handle sensitive personal and operational information. High-profile incidents, such as ransomware attacks on municipal systems reported by the U.S. Cybersecurity and Infrastructure Security Agency (CISA), underscore vulnerabilities that can disrupt critical public safety operations. These security challenges heighten operational risk and elevate compliance costs for manufacturers and service providers, affecting budget allocations and deployment timelines. Established firms must invest heavily in robust encryption and continuous monitoring, while smaller entrants face resource constraints in meeting stringent security demands. Moving forward, escalating regulatory scrutiny from entities like the European Union Agency for Cybersecurity (ENISA) suggests that cybersecurity and privacy protections will remain a pivotal restraint, compelling market players to prioritize resilience and trustworthiness to secure stakeholder confidence.

Interoperability and Standardization Limitations

The fragmented ecosystem of proprietary protocols and inconsistent standards across vendors limits seamless integration of IoT devices for public safety applications. Organizations such as the National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ST) highlight that lack of interoperability complicates data sharing between emergency services, undermining coordinated response efforts. This results in increased operational inefficiencies and inflated costs due to redundant infrastructure and integration efforts. For corporations, navigating diverse technical requirements delays time-to-market and heightens support burdens, while startups struggle to differentiate offerings within a complex standards landscape. In the medium term, collaborative initiatives like the Open Connectivity Foundationโ€™s drive toward unified standards and government-backed mandates for compatibility will be critical to mitigating this constraint, enabling more scalable and cohesive IoT deployments in public safety domains.

North America Market Statistics:

North America dominated the iot for public safety market with a commanding 39% share in 2025, underscoring its status as the largest regional player. This leadership stems principally from robust government investment in smart city initiatives and public safety infrastructure, which drives widespread adoption of IoT technologies across urban centers. Agencies like the U.S. Department of Homeland Security have actively funded advancements in connected cameras, sensors, and emergency response systems, fostering a resilient ecosystem. Additionally, the regionโ€™s emphasis on digital transformation within public safety frameworks aligns with rising urbanization and evolving security needs, as highlighted by the National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ST). North Americaโ€™s regulatory encouragement for interoperable systems and cross-agency data sharing further accelerates IoT implementation in public safety. These multifaceted dynamics position the region to capitalize on growing demand for integrated safety solutions, promising sustained innovation and market expansion.

The United States anchors the North American iot for public safety market, driven by comprehensive federal and state-level policies encouraging smart city deployments and critical infrastructure modernization. Agencies such as the Federal Emergency Management Agency (FEMA) have promoted IoT adoption to enhance disaster response capabilities and real-time situational awareness. Corporate leaders like CISCO have partnered with municipalities to deploy IoT-enabled surveillance and communication networks, reflecting strong private-public collaboration. Meanwhile, consumer demand for safer urban environments reinforces adoption trends in cities like New York and San Francisco. This synergy of public investment, technological innovation, and societal safety expectations amplifies the U.S.โ€™s pivotal role in shaping North Americaโ€™s iot for public safety market trajectory.

Asia Pacific Market Analysis:

Asia Pacific emerged as the fastest-growing region in the IoT for public safety market, registering a rapid growth rate with a robust CAGR of 18.6%. This exceptional expansion is primarily driven by accelerating urbanization, rising public safety concerns, and extensive smart city initiatives across the region. Governments and municipal authorities in APAC are increasingly prioritizing public safety through digital transformation strategies, leveraging IoT-enabled devices to enhance emergency response times and improve real-time surveillance capacities. For instance, Singaporeโ€™s Smart Nation program and Indiaโ€™s Digital India initiative underscore heightened investments in intelligent infrastructure, which bolster efficiency and resilience. Regulatory frameworks supporting technology integration are also evolving to facilitate secure data management and interoperability among IoT platforms. Given these dynamics, Asia Pacific presents a fertile landscape for investors and technology providers focusing on innovative, scalable solutions tailored to diverse urban environments.

Japan plays a pivotal role in the Asia Pacific IoT for public safety market, distinguished by its advanced technological infrastructure and a mature digital ecosystem. The countryโ€™s focus on integrating IoT within public safety is amplified by its need to respond efficiently to frequent natural disasters, such as earthquakes and typhoons. The Japanese governmentโ€™s โ€œSociety 5.0โ€ initiative exemplifies its commitment to embedding IoT across all sectors, including enhanced emergency alert systems and automated risk detection, as seen in recent deployments by NTT and SoftBank. Consumers in Japan demonstrate strong adoption of smart safety devices, supported by regulatory policies fostering innovation while protecting privacy. Japanโ€™s lead in operationalizing IoT solutions reinforces the broader regional opportunity by setting benchmarks for resilience and technological excellence.

Chinaโ€™s expanding role within the Asia Pacific region is defined by large-scale smart city deployments and extensive urban expansion, which intensify the demand for IoT in public safety applications. The countryโ€™s strategic programs like the National New Urbanization Plan and the Integrated Urban Emergency Management System emphasize data-driven public safety frameworks incorporating AI and IoT technologies. Companies such as Huawei and Alibaba Cloud are spearheading advances in sensor networks and AI-powered analytics to proactively manage crowd control, traffic safety, and crime prevention. Urban residents increasingly expect seamless connectivity and real-time safety alerts, which drives procurement of sophisticated IoT solutions. As China continues to scale smart infrastructure, it reinforces the regionโ€™s growth trajectory and offers significant avenues for cooperation and innovation within the IoT for public safety market.

Europe Market Trends:

Europe held a substantial share in the IoT for public safety market, driven by the regionโ€™s advanced digital infrastructure and proactive regulatory frameworks that prioritize citizen security and data privacy. Increasing investments from both public sectors and private enterprises in smart city initiatives, alongside collaboration among entities like the European Union Agency for Cybersecurity (ENISA), have fostered a robust environment for IoT adoption. The growing demand for real-time monitoring systems and integrated emergency response platforms reflects changing consumer expectations and government mandates aimed at enhancing urban safety. Additionally, Europe's commitment to sustainability and resilience has reinforced the deployment of energy-efficient, interconnected devices, further strengthening the market position. With continuous technological innovations and a highly skilled workforce, Europe is poised for ongoing growth, offering compelling opportunities for stakeholders focused on scalable and secure public safety solutions.

Germany stands as a key market within the European IoT for public safety landscape, propelled by its strong industrial base and government-led smart infrastructure programs. The Federal Ministry of the Interiorโ€™s initiatives to implement intelligent surveillance and early warning systems illustrate a national priority for enhanced public security. Furthermore, German companies such as Siemens and Bosch are increasingly integrating IoT-enabled safety features into public infrastructure and emergency services, showcasing technological leadership. This dynamic contributes to a competitive yet collaborative environment where innovation thrives, helping Germany sustain its pivotal role in shaping regional market trends. Consequently, Germanyโ€™s strategic emphasis on combining technology with regulatory compliance underscores broader European prospects in advancing public safety through IoT.

France plays a significant role in Europe's IoT for public safety market, capitalizing on regulatory reforms that strengthen data protection and stimulate smart city developments. The French governmentโ€™s support through entities like the National Cybersecurity Agency of France (ANSSI) has accelerated the adoption of secure IoT ecosystems critical for public safety applications. French urban centers, particularly Paris, are pioneers in deploying AI-powered surveillance and disaster management systems that employ IoT sensors to enhance situational awareness. This focus on integrating advanced technologies within public safety frameworks reflects the countryโ€™s commitment to innovation and citizen protection. Franceโ€™s proactive posture in public safety IoT solutions complements Europeโ€™s overall market growth, reinforcing the region as a fertile ground for investment and technological advancement.

Segment Leadership and Growth Trends

Go Beyond the Chart, Access Full Insights & Data Tables
  Analysis by Component

The solution segment held the largest share of the IoT for public safety market in 2025, driven by the rising integration of IoT solutions like real-time monitoring and data analytics that significantly enhance public safety operations and emergency response efficiency. This leadership reflects a growing preference among public safety agencies for scalable, software-driven frameworks that enable rapid decision-making and resource allocation. Organisations such as Cisco and IBM have emphasized advanced IoT solution deployments in their public safety portfolios, reinforcing competitive dynamics anchored in digital transformation. The segment offers strategic opportunities for both established technology vendors and agile start-ups to innovate around customizable, interoperable solutions. As cities and governments increasingly prioritize smart urban resilience and regulatory compliance, the solution segment is set to maintain its central role in advancing integrated public safety infrastructures.

Analysis by Application

Surveillance and security represented the largest share within the IoT for public safety market in 2025, propelled by the widespread deployment of connected cameras and sensors in urban environments to boost real-time monitoring capabilities. This dominance is driven by escalating concerns over urban safety and the demand for continuous situational awareness, supported by technology advancements improving sensor accuracy and data interoperability. Notably, the U.S. Department of Homeland Security has invested heavily in sensor networks for public venues, reflecting regulatory and operational priorities that influence market adoption patterns. The segment presents considerable advantages for incumbents and innovators developing AI-enabled analytics and edge computing devices. Given ongoing urbanization trends and smart city initiatives, surveillance and security applications are expected to remain indispensable in public safety ecosystems.

Analysis by Vertical

Homeland security held the largest share of the IoT for public safety market in 2025, propelled by rising global focus on national security and investments in advanced real-time monitoring and threat detection systems. This leadership is underscored by heightened governmental and international agency spending patterns that prioritize integrated threat intelligence and rapid response frameworks. For instance, agencies like the European Union Agency for Cybersecurity (ENISA) have underscored the critical need for IoT-enabled situational awareness in counter-terrorism efforts. The segment benefits from evolving workforce expertise in cybersecurity and defense IoT technologies, fostering competitive innovation. Homeland securityโ€™s persistent strategic importance ensures sustained deployment of sophisticated IoT platforms, securing its relevance amid evolving geopolitical and technological landscapes.

Key players in the IoT for public safety market include Honeywell, Cisco Systems, Motorola Solutions, Siemens, Bosch, Huawei, NEC Corporation, Airbus, Thales Group, and Johnson Controls. These companies are strategically positioned across key industrial hubs, leveraging their technological strengths and longstanding industry credibility to influence market dynamics. Honeywell, Cisco, and Motorola Solutions drive innovation with integrated safety systems, while Siemens and Bosch enhance infrastructure resilience via advanced sensors. Huawei and NEC bring strong IoT connectivity and AI capabilities, pivotal in data-driven public safety solutions. Airbus and Thales Group extend their aerospace and defense expertise to critical safety applications, while Johnson Controls provides comprehensive building management integrations. Collectively, these market leaders demonstrate deep domain expertise and technological diversification, sustaining their influence across evolving public safety requirements.

The competitive landscape is characterized by active technology integration and cooperative ventures among top players. Investments in sensor fusion, AI analytics, and edge computing underpin new product introductions aimed at real-time threat detection and incident management. Collaborations linking cybersecurity firms with IoT providers enhance the robustness of safety networks. Acquisitions and partnerships have broadened technological portfolios, enabling comprehensive, interoperable solutions that cater to complex urban environments. The pursuit of standardization and scalable platforms serves to differentiate these companies, fortifying their market positions and accelerating innovation cycles. Leading entities continuously refine their end-to-end offerings to meet escalating demands for proactive, data-driven public safety operations.
